    Calcium deficiency in children may be manifested as unsteady sleep, easy to wake up, night terrors, irritability, crying, sweating, occipital baldness, and can also lead to rib valgus, hand and foot bracelets, square skull and other bone deformation.

    Calcium deficiency in children can be manifested as growth retardation, late teething, X-shaped legs or O-shaped legs, square heads, beaded ribs, chicken breasts, etc.

    Calcium deficiency has a serious impact on children's growth and development. Vitamin D can promote the body's absorption of calcium, and calcium deficiency in children is closely related to vitamin D deficiency. Early children with calcium deficiency may develop more slowly than children of the same age, and teeth may erupt later.

    If calcium deficiency occurs in infancy, the child may be startled, irritable, sweating, and crying at night, and the child may have occipital hair loss and a square head, with delayed fontanelle closing. In addition, children with calcium deficiency may develop skeletal deformities, such as chicken breasts, beaded ribs, and X-shaped or O-shaped legs. At the same time, children with calcium deficiency will also be more susceptible to colds and other infectious diseases than normal children due to the decline of immunity.

    Therefore, parents should prevent their children from calcium deficiency by supplementing vitamin D, taking their children outdoors to bask in the sun, and appropriately supplementing calcium-rich foods.
